xref: /PHP-7.2/Zend/tests/bug26697.phpt (revision 162aa1a5)
1--TEST--
2Bug #26697 (calling class_exists on a nonexistent class in __autoload results in segfault)
3--FILE--
4<?php
5
6spl_autoload_register(function ($name) {
7	echo __METHOD__ . "($name)\n";
8	var_dump(class_exists('NotExistingClass'));
9	echo __METHOD__ . "($name), done\n";
10});
11
12var_dump(class_exists('NotExistingClass'));
13
14?>
15===DONE===
16--EXPECTF--
17{closure}(NotExistingClass)
18bool(false)
19{closure}(NotExistingClass), done
20bool(false)
21===DONE===
22